1. Introduction
The Dooya DM25CE/L is a versatile DC tubular motor designed for smart home integration, specifically for motorized roller blinds. It features remote control capabilities, smartphone control, and can be powered by various sources including adaptors, rechargeable battery bars, or solar panels. This manual provides essential information for the safe installation, operation, and maintenance of your DM25CE/L tubular motor.

4. Product Overview
The DM25CE/L is a compact and efficient tubular motor designed for integration into roller blind systems. Key features include:
- Electronic Limit: Precise control over upper and lower stop positions.
- Built-in Receiver: Allows for wireless control via remote or smart devices.
- DC Power: Operates on 12V DC, suitable for various power options including battery and solar.
- Smartphone Control: Compatible with smart home systems like Tuya and Zigbee for advanced automation.
- Stall Protection: Prevents damage to the motor if the blind encounters an obstruction.
- Jog & Tilt: Fine-tune blind position or slat angle (if applicable).
- Program Button: For easy setup and pairing.
- Speed Regulation: Adjust the operating speed of the blind.
- Memorized Setting: Retains programmed limits and preferred positions.
- Scene Control: Integrate into smart home scenes for automated operation.
- Solar Charging: Option to power and charge using solar panels (e.g., DC683B).
5. Setup and Installation
5.1 Mechanical Installation
The DM25CE/L motor is designed to fit inside a Ø25mm tubular roller blind. Ensure the motor is securely mounted within the blind tube and the blind is properly installed in its brackets. The motor's limit head (Figure 4) should align correctly with the blind mechanism.
5.2 Electrical Connection and Power Options
The motor operates on 12V DC. Connect the power line to a suitable 12V DC power source. The motor features a small connector for easy attachment.
- Adaptor Power: Connect the motor to a DC240(I/J/K) adaptor.
- Battery Bar Power: Use a 12V rechargeable battery bar (e.g., DC224 or DC224A).
- Solar Power: The DM25CE/L can be powered by a solar panel. For charging DC224A battery bars, DC683B solar panels or DC520 chargers can be used.
5.3 Pairing with Remote Control / Smart System
The motor has a built-in receiver. To pair with a remote control (e.g., DC2700, DC2702, DC2760) or a smart home system (Tuya/Zigbee via a compatible hub):
- Ensure the motor is powered on.
- Locate the program button on the motor or the remote control (refer to your remote's manual for specific instructions).
- Follow the pairing procedure outlined in your remote control or smart hub's documentation. Typically, this involves pressing the program button on the motor, then a button on the remote/app to establish a connection.
- The motor can store a maximum of 20 channels. If more than 20 channels are programmed, the oldest channel will be overwritten.

6.2 Setting Limits and Preferred Stop Positions
The DM25CE/L features electronic limits and a preferred stop position. Refer to your remote control or smart home app's instructions for the exact procedure to set these:
- Setting Upper/Lower Limits: Typically involves moving the blind to the desired upper or lower position and then pressing a combination of buttons on the remote (often the program button and up/down).
- Setting Preferred Stop Position: Move the blind to an intermediate desired position and save it as a preferred stop. This allows for quick recall to a favorite position.

8.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Motor does not respond to remote/app. | No power; Remote battery low; Motor not paired; Obstruction. | Check power connection; Replace remote battery; Re-pair motor; Check for obstructions. |
| Blind stops unexpectedly. | Obstruction detected (stall protection); Power interruption. | Remove obstruction; Check power supply. |
| Limits are incorrect. | Limits not set or incorrectly set. | Re-program upper and lower limits according to remote/app instructions. |
| Motor makes unusual noise. | Mechanical issue; Obstruction. | Check for any mechanical issues with the blind or motor mounting; Remove obstructions. |
9. Specifications
|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Model | DM25CE/L |
| Rated Voltage | 12V DC |
| Rated Torque | 1.1 Nm |
| Rated Speed | 32 Rpm |
| Radio Frequency | 433 MHz (Radio+) |
| Rated Current | 0.99 A |
| Rated Power | 12 W |
| Degree of Protection (IP) | IP20 |
| Maximum Limit Turn | ∞ |
| Running Time | >6 minutes |
| Working Temperature | 0°C - 40°C (some variants -10°C ~ +55°C) |
| Length (L1/L2) | 344mm / 326mm (approx. 30cm / 11.8 inches) |
| Certification | CE, FCC-ID |
| Material | Metal |
| Max. Fabric Size (Ø38 tube) | 13.8 m² (with bottom beam 1kg, fabric 0.5kg/m²) |
